Java开发环境配置全攻略:从JDK到IDE

需积分: 1 2 下载量 182 浏览量 更新于2024-08-03 收藏 18KB DOCX 举报
"Java开发环境配置指南,涵盖了JDK安装、IDE选择、环境配置和问题解决等内容,旨在帮助开发者建立高效稳定的Java开发环境。" 在Java开发中,配置一个良好的开发环境是至关重要的,它直接影响到开发效率和项目的顺利进行。本指南详细介绍了配置Java开发环境的步骤和注意事项,主要包括以下几个方面: 一、安装JDK JDK(Java Development Kit)是Java开发的基础,包含了编译、运行Java程序所需的所有工具。首先,你需要从Oracle官网下载与操作系统匹配的JDK安装包。在安装完成后,你需要配置环境变量,以便系统可以找到JDK。对于Windows用户,需将JDK的安装路径添加到JAVA_HOME和Path变量中;而对于Linux/Mac用户,需编辑相应的shell配置文件(如.bashrc或.bash_profile)。 二、选择和配置IDE IDE(Integrated Development Environment)是提升开发效率的重要工具。本指南推荐了Eclipse、IntelliJ IDEA和NetBeans三个主流的Java IDE。Eclipse以其强大的功能和灵活性受到广泛使用,IntelliJ IDEA以其智能代码辅助和性能分析见长,而NetBeans则以其易用性和轻量级特性适合初学者。选择IDE时,应考虑项目规模、团队需求以及个人偏好。每个IDE都有其官方网站提供下载,并附有详细的安装和配置指南。 三、配置开发环境 1. 编码和格式化规范:为了保证代码的一致性和可读性,你需要在IDE中设置统一的编码格式,如UTF-8,并配置代码格式化规则。 2. 自动完成和模板:启用代码自动完成功能,可以显著提高编码速度。自定义代码模板,可以避免重复输入常见的代码片段。 3. 快捷键配置:根据个人习惯设置快捷键,能够大幅提升开发效率。 4. 版本控制集成:安装Git客户端,并在IDE中集成,用于管理代码版本和团队协作。学会如何克隆项目、提交更改和解决冲突是必备技能。 四、构建工具和常用库 现代Java开发往往涉及构建工具,如Maven或Gradle,它们自动化构建过程,管理依赖关系。了解如何配置和使用这些工具对项目管理至关重要。此外,还需要了解如何添加和管理常用的Java库,如Spring Framework、Apache Commons等,以满足项目需求。 五、常见问题及解决 在配置过程中可能会遇到各种问题,如JDK版本不兼容、IDE安装失败或配置错误等。本指南还会提供这些问题的解决方案,帮助开发者顺利解决。 本指南为Java开发者提供了一个全面的参考,无论你是新手还是经验丰富的开发者,都能从中受益,快速搭建起一个符合最佳实践的Java开发环境。通过遵循这些步骤和建议,你可以确保自己的开发环境既高效又稳定,从而更专注于代码编写和项目开发。